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32248338 271 87
56913822 384794155 779
56913822 384794155 779
65180 42765934 268339 60
All about undefined
Interested in learning more?
56913822 384794155 779
65180 42765934 268339 60
See more
485514 373
981461107 02332010974 076699008
See more
8524 34 022071284
728786 1309 44
See more